pow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/ База_данных_Клиники
21 сообщений из 21, страница 1 из 1
База_данных_Клиники
    #38187296
aslan1980
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Добрый день знатоки

Спроектировал схему для одной из частной клиник, хотелось бы чтобы вы посмотрели все как сделано. Хотелось бы узнать ваше мнение

Нужно чтобы была спроектировано БД для клиники, которая могла хранит инфрамацию о пациентах, врачах, приемах диагнозах, лечениях.

Даются следующие процедуры.

Пациенту может быть назначено несколько приемов у одного или более врачей клиники, а врач может принимать несколько пациентов
Однако каждый назначенный прием делается только одним врачом, и каждый назначенный прием относится к единственному пациенту

Экстренные случаи не требуют предварительного назначенного приема. Однако экстренные случаи заносится в книгу как прием вне расписания, чтобы можно было контролировать назначенные визиты.

Если все идет чередом, то прием состоится в назначенное время. Результатом посещения будут диагноз и, при необходимости назначенное лечение.

Вот сама схема пожалуйста проверти ее



При каждом визите обновляется запись в истории болезни пациента

При каждом визите пациенту выписывается чек на оплату. Каждый чек за висит выписывается одним врачом, и каждый врач может выписать чек нескольким пациентам

Каждый чек должен быть оплачен. Однако чек может быть оплачен несколькими способами, а платеж может погашать сразу более одного чека.

Пациент может оплатить чек на прямую или на основе соглашения о медицинском страховании на своем предприятии

Если чек оплачивается страховой компанией, пациент освобождается от платы в соответствии с его страховой программой.
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187361
Злой Бобр
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
aslan1980,

Если вы действительно считаете что БД состоит всего из 3 таблиц - займитесь чем-то более полезным. Просто после вас придется все писать заново.
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187403
Фотография Программист-Любитель
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
aslan1980Добрый день знатоки
Спроектировал схему для одной из частной клиник, хотелось бы чтобы вы посмотрели все как сделано. Хотелось бы узнать ваше мнение
Даже не смешно.
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187416
aslan1980
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Злой Бобр.

Вы сами та посмотрите на бизнес процедуры. А что вы предлогаете ?

Кот Матроскин, не понял что это значит не смешно
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187421
aslan1980
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Злой бобр а чего ты такой злой а ?
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187463
Злой Бобр
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
aslan1980,

Ну а Вы перечитайте еще раз мой пост. Там есть мое предложение.
И вовсе я не злой ...
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187563
aslan1980
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Злой бобр, я знаю что база будет состоять из несколько таблиц.

Я вас знатоков попросил, чтобы вы пока посмотрели эту структуру, что в ней правильно, а что нет.

Правильно ли деланно структура, написанным мною бизнес процедурам.

Вот и все.
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187576
Фотография Программист-Любитель
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ТС, судя по вашим вопросам вы несведущи ни в лечебном деле, ни в разработке приложений БД. Сделанная вами попытка решения не тянет даже на учебный пример. Из того, что вы сформулировали, у вас получилось выделить только три сущности - это ничтожно мало.

Я невеликий спец в лечебном виде, за последние пять лет бы в поликлиннике раза два, но знаний на уровне здравого смысла уже достаточно, чтобы сделать такие резкие, неприятные для вас выводы. Увы, но это так.

Для примера:
Врач может заболеть и обратиться к своему коллеге.
Факьтические приемы и запланированные могут разительно отличаться друг от друга.
Один визит к врачу бывает недостаточен для постановки диагноза.
За один визит больному могут быть оказаны разные услуги/процедуры и т.п. каждый по своему виду лечения.
У вас ничего нет про симптомы, назначенные анализы и обследования, их результаты, оплату счетов, виды медицинских услуг у вас никак не классифицированы, врачей нельзя разделить по специальностям, категории классификации

в опщем ни хрена у вас нету кроме трех грустных таблиц...
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187580
Фотография Сид
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
aslan1980,

Структура в корне неправильная. Уточняйте бизнес-требования. Сидите вместе с сотрудниками и подмечайте, как они работают. И не надо объединять лечение с чеками в одной таблице. Тем более, это далеко не одно поле. Осмотр специалиста - это ~20 полей (плюс-минус). И в одном чеке может быть несколько осмотров (а также исследований, операций, манипуляций, процедур, лабораторных анализов и т.д.). Мало того, если имеем дело с ДМС, то там вообще всё по-другому считается. Плюс возможность доплаты наличными, если услуга не входит в ДМС. А если у клиники есть или планируется стационар, то можно будет закопаться на 10+ лет разработки (клинике будет проще отвалить N лямов за готовую систему с допилом).
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187768
Злой Бобр
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
aslan1980,

Задавайте конкретный вопрос, тогда может и получите ответ. А тот поток, который вы назвали бизнес-процедурами, лишь частично соответствует схеме. Кроме того вырванный кусок из ТЗ может полностью или частично исказить представление о структуре БД. Поэтому еще раз - займитесь чем-то более полезным . Ну не каждому дано горшки лепить.
Мы втроем делали перевод больницы с бумажек на электронную систему. В итоге лишь небольшой участок занял 8 месяцев. Так что если вы думаете что без опыта сможете вот так, на коленке, побыстрячку слепить рабочую БД - это самообман.
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187790
Лагман
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
aslan1980,


aslan1980проверти ее

Провертел схему.

Как минимум из текста
aslan1980При каждом визите обновляется запись в истории болезни пациента

При каждом визите пациенту выписывается чек на оплату. Каждый чек за висит выписывается одним врачом, и каждый врач может выписать чек нескольким пациентам

Каждый чек должен быть оплачен. Однако чек может быть оплачен несколькими способами, а платеж может погашать сразу более одного чека.

Пациент может оплатить чек на прямую или на основе соглашения о медицинском страховании на своем предприятии

Если чек оплачивается страховой компанией, пациент освобождается от платы в соответствии с его страховой программой.

вылезают сущности:
пациент, визит, история болезни, чек на оплату, врач, оплата
плюс отдельная подсистема по расчету задолженности пациента и взаимоотношениями кто за кого платит
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187874
Cane Cat Fisher
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Программист-ЛюбительДля примера:
Врач может заболеть и обратиться к своему коллеге.


..и что, на этом основании Вы предлагаете объединить сущности "Врач" и "Пациент" в "Человек"?
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187984
Фотография vadiminfo
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Программист-Любительв опщем ни хрена у вас нету кроме трех грустных таблиц...

Однако, есть еще вера во врачей, которая исключает, что

Программист-Любитель
Врач может заболеть.....
...

и тем более

Программист-Любительобратиться к своему коллеге.
...
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38187994
Лагман
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Cane Cat Fisher,

С другой стороны, паспорта у нас все-таки не по профессиям выдают.
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38188004
aslan1980
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Злой бобр я хочу и буду липить горжки
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38188896
Злой Бобр
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
aslan1980Злой бобр я хочу и буду липить горжки
Наздоровье. Если клиент платит - гуляйте по полной, ни в чем себе не отказывайте.
Удачи и как говорится - быстрых вам ног.
)))
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38189012
aslan1980
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Злой бобр у меня к тебе вопрос.

А ты как родился сразу же научился горжки липить да ?
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38190073
vladimir74
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
а чего все так тут наехали на человека?
нормально все!
Только вам база данных не нужна. установите каждому врачу на комп Excel и пусть там пишет что хочет...

PS хотя возможно я не прав и у вас гос. заказ. Тогда вам нужен как минимум Oracle.

PPS Если это и в впямь заказ, возьмите меня в долю, я вам табличку кабинетов нарисую
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38190326
Лагман
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
vladimir74а чего все так тут наехали на человека?
нормально все!
Только вам база данных не нужна. установите каждому врачу на комп Excel и пусть там пишет что хочет...

PS хотя возможно я не прав и у вас гос. заказ. Тогда вам нужен как минимум Oracle.

PPS Если это и в впямь заказ, возьмите меня в долю, я вам табличку кабинетов нарисую
Если госзаказ то можно просто оракл и эксель, зачем что-то рисовать
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38190458
vladimir74
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ЛагманЕсли госзаказ то можно просто оракл и эксель, зачем что-то рисовать
жаль, а ведь какая была возможность улучшить благосостояние отдельно взятой ячеки общества...
...
Рейтинг: 0 / 0
База_данных_Клиники
    #38191027
mad_nazgul
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
aslan1980Добрый день знатоки
Спроектировал схему для одной из частной клиник, хотелось бы чтобы вы посмотрели все как сделано. Хотелось бы узнать ваше мнение


Мое мнение - сыро.

1) Выясните какие у вас будут входные формы, какие выходные, какие нужны будут отчеты
2) Выясните какие будут роли
3) Выяснить разграничение прав ролей
4) На основании форм и ролей начертить схему их взаимодействия
5) На основании схемы (п. 4) создать схему сущностей и связей
6) На основании схемы (п. 5) спроектировать БД

Где-то так, но это если по быстрому.

<:o)
...
Рейтинг: 0 / 0
21 сообщений из 21, страница 1 из 1
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/ База_данных_Клиники
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]